    Kern Medical has been a community cornerstone since its founding in 1867. Today, we are an acute care teaching center with 222 beds, offering the only advanced trauma care between Fresno and Los Angeles.Kern Medical offers a range of primary, specialty, and multi-specialty services including high-risk pregnancy care, inpatient psychiatric services integrated with county mental health programs, and a growing network of outpatient clinics providing personalized patient-centered wellness care. Kern Medical cares for 15,500 inpatients and 125,000 clinic patients a year.

    Definition:

    Under the supervision of a nurse leader (Chief Nursing Officer, Clinical Director, Clinical Supervisor and Clinical Nurse Leader), independently prescribes, delegates and coordinates nursing care to the acutely ill patient and performs the nursing process through assessment, planning, implementation and evaluation of safe, therapeutic care for patients The scope of practice is in accordance with the ANA Scope and Standards of Practice, ANA Code of Ethics and California Nurse Practice Act Board of Registered Nurses of the State of California.

    Distinguishing Characteristics:

    This classification ranges from novice nurse with limited knowledge and skills to expert nurse with advanced knowledge and skills, and the ability to perform work with minimum supervision. It is designed to accommodate the expanding experience of the Registered Nurse (RN) resulting in the ability to orient nurses with limited experience and re-entry nurses to current clinical practice. The HSN is expected to be committed to enhancing the profession of nursing, actively seek to improve their professional practice, contribute to the professional development of others, demonstrate caring-healing practices and promote the vision and goals of the organization and Department of Nursing. All nursing clinical practice will be evaluated and governed through the Chief Nursing Officer (CNO) and/or their RN designee.
